In message <C0170D0AF1277849A4B4518034F855DD0F90C6 at aiexchange.ai.aiinet.com> you wrote: > > I am currently looking into using the ISP1362 as a host > controller on a Freescale (Motorola) MPC880 running Linux 2.4.23. I > have noticed posts where others have also use this part with the MPC880. > I was wondering if anyone could let me know what driver they were using > and where I could possibly obtain it. If anyone could also tell me if > they were successful using this driver, I would greatly appreciate it.
See the linuxppc_2_4_devel module on our CVS server. Our driver for the ISP1362 has been tested for host function (memory stick, USB modem, USB-serial adapter, USB network adapter), device function (network device) and as gadget driver (communicating with Windows PC using RNDIS drivers). The code is stable.
